Peque Fernández is a 23-year-old football player who plays as a attacking midfielder for Sevilla, born on October 4, 2002, who is right-footed. In the 2025/2026 LaLiga season, Peque Fernández has recorded 2 goals, 1 assist, 891 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 6.68, 8 yellow cards.

Peque Fernández's career has also included time at Racing Santander, Barca Atletic, and UE Cornella.

On the international stage, Peque Fernández has represented Spain U21.

Throughout their career, Peque Fernández has won 1 title: División de Honor Juvenil (2021/2022) with Barcelona U19.
